制作做的网站如何上传网上:老站长的血泪经验,别再被忽悠了
本文关键词:制作做的网站如何上传网上
干了七年建站,我见过太多老板拿着做好的源码,一脸懵逼地问我:“老师,这文件我都打包好了,咋就显示不出来呢?”或者更惨的,花大价钱找人做了个站,结果对方跑路了,留一堆代码在那吃灰。今天不整那些虚头巴脑的理论,就聊聊咱们普通人怎么把制作做的网站如何上传网上这个事儿办利索。
先说个真事儿。上个月有个做餐饮的朋友找我,说他在某宝花三百块买了个模板,卖家发了个压缩包给他。他兴致勃勃地解压,里面全是html文件,还有几个img文件夹。他直接双击index.html,浏览器打开了,觉得成了。结果发给客户看,客户说全是红叉叉,图片加载不出来。为啥?因为他以为本地能看就是上线了。这就像你在家把菜炒好了,觉得香,但没端上桌给别人吃,那不算请客吃饭。
要把网站真正放到网上,核心就两步:买空间(服务器)和传文件。别一听“服务器”就觉得高大上,对于中小企业官网,买个虚拟主机或者轻量级云服务器足矣。我现在用的阿里云轻量应用服务器,一年也就两三百块钱,带宽2M-3M,跑个静态页面或者简单的WordPress完全够用。别去听那些忽悠你买几万块集群的,那是给大厂准备的。
第一步,搞定域名和主机。域名就是网址,比如你的公司名拼音。主机就是存放网站文件的那个“硬盘”。买的时候认准正规大厂,别贪便宜买那种不知名的小机房,昨天还在,今天就打不开了,数据丢了哭都来不及。拿到主机后,你会得到一个FTP账号和密码,或者一个后台登录地址。FTP就像个网盘,只不过它是专门用来传网站文件的。
第二步,上传文件。这是最容易踩坑的地方。很多人直接用浏览器打开FTP,拖拽文件,结果发现图片全裂了。这是因为路径没对应上。正确的做法是用专业的FTP软件,比如FileZilla,免费好用。连接上服务器后,左边是你电脑里的文件,右边是服务器空间。找到wwwroot或者public_html这个文件夹,这就是网站的根目录。把你本地的所有文件,包括html、css、js、images,全部拖进去。注意,一定要保持文件夹结构一致,别把图片扔根目录,代码却在子文件夹里找,那肯定报错。
上传过程中,有个细节很多人忽略:文件名大小写。Linux服务器对大小写敏感,index.html和Index.html是两个东西。如果你本地开发时用的是大写,上传后访问小写,那就404了。所以,上传前最好统一改成小写,省得后期排查问题头大。
上传完后,别急着走。打开浏览器,输入你的域名。如果看到熟悉的界面,恭喜你,成了。如果报错,别慌,看浏览器F12开发者工具里的Network标签,看看是哪个文件404了,通常是图片路径写错了,或者CSS文件没传上去。
最后说点心里话。建站这事儿,技术门槛其实不高,难的是维护。上传只是开始,后续的SSL证书配置、域名解析、定期备份才是重头戏。很多老板觉得传上去就万事大吉,结果半年后网站被挂马,或者打开速度极慢,那时候再找人就晚了。
记住,制作做的网站如何上传网上并不是终点,而是起点。找个靠谱的合作伙伴,或者自己多学点基础知识,比盲目追求低价重要得多。毕竟,网站是你公司的门面,它要是打不开,客户怎么信任你?
我就说这么多,都是这些年摔跟头摔出来的经验。希望能帮到正在折腾的你。如果有啥不懂的,多在搜索引擎里查查,或者看看官方文档,别总指望别人喂到嘴边。这行水挺深,但只要你踏实,总能找到出路。